Addressing Wildlife Habitat Loss in Alaska
Alaska, known for its expansive wilderness and diverse ecosystems, faces increasing challenges due to climate change, which threatens wildlife habitats. With rising temperatures causing shifts in vegetation and animal behaviors, the need for effective conservation strategies has become more pressing. According to the Alaska Department of Fish and Game, approximately 50% of the state's wildlife species are experiencing habitat loss due to ongoing environmental changes. This puts immense pressure on local conservation efforts to adapt and protect these vital ecosystems.
Conservation organizations, policymakers, and local communities are the primary stakeholders addressing these issues in Alaska. Many communities depend on healthy wildlife populations for subsistence and cultural practices, making habitat protection a priority. However, the remoteness and vastness of Alaska often means that organizations operate with limited data on wildlife distributions and habitat conditions, making targeted conservation actions challenging.
The proposed grant will leverage advanced geospatial analytics to enhance wildlife habitat conservation efforts across the state. By developing a comprehensive data system that allows for continuous monitoring of wildlife populations, the initiative aims to provide local conservation organizations and policymakers with critical insights into habitat changes. This data-driven approach will facilitate effective conservation strategies, ensuring that efforts are focused on the areas requiring the most attention.
Teams will work collaboratively with local stakeholders to map critical habitats, collect data on species populations, and assess the impacts of habitat changes over time. Training sessions on utilizing geospatial tools will be offered, enhancing awareness and skills among conservation practitioners. The overarching goal is to create a robust monitoring framework that supports long-term habitat preservation, ensuring that Alaska's unique biodiversity is maintained for future generations.
